    Thanx for the overwhelming replies guys.I started off with a younger pacino, approximately when he was young like in scarface. Later on when I kept working, he kept getting older, and I ended up making him look like he currently is. While this transformation took place, I failed to notice that his eyes had changed considerably as he became older.And the biggest problem was exporting displacement and normal maps from zbrush and getting the sss shaders to work in max. I lost quite a bit on that. so, not entirely satisfied with my 3d render, I decided to make a 2d paint over on it. There's not too much paintover, but the minor details have been enhanced, and the image has been colour corrected. Here are some wires. Thats the reason for his face becoming a lil fatter I guess. I'll try to make some corrections and post updates in the next post
